Empaths are highly sensitive individuals who can easily pick up on the emotions and thoughts of those around them. They have a deep understanding of human emotions and are often driven by a desire to help others. Here are the 11 traits of an empath:

  1. Strong Empathy: Empaths experience emotions deeply and can relate to the experiences of others in a profound way.

  2. Intuitive: Empaths have a strong intuition and often receive information without concrete evidence.

  3. Overwhelming Sensitivity to Energy: Empaths can become overwhelmed by the emotions and energies of those around them, which can lead to feeling drained.

  4. Emotional Intake: Empaths absorb the emotions of others and may feel them as their own, which can be exhausting.

  5. Prefer solitude: Empaths often require alone time to recharge and maintain their emotional well-being.

  6. Healer Potential: Empaths have a natural inclination towards healing and holistic practices.

  7. Heightened Senses: Empaths have enhanced abilities to perceive and respond to the emotions of others, even in low-light or noisy environments.

  8. Rare Bloodline: Empaths may have a genetic predisposition for empathetic traits.

  9. Sensitive to Chaos: Empaths are Highly sensitive to environmental chaos and can find the noise and hustle of crowded places stressful.

  10. Emotional Reactivity: Empaths find themselves easily triggered by the emotions of others and may struggle to remain calm in challenging situations.

  11. Mental and Emotional Drainage: Constant exposure to the emotions of others can lead to mental and emotional exhaustion.

Empaths often have a unique ability to connect with others but also face unique challenges, such as emotional overload, loneliness, and balance. They need to find ways to manage their sensitivity and prioritize self-care to thrive.
